Photo Caption:
George W. Warrington II is shown here standing in front of the Montauk Point keeper’s quarters wearing his new Coast Guard uniform shortly after he stopped being a civilian lighthouse keeper and joined the Coast Guard as a military lighthouse keeper in August of 1942. He had previously served in the Coast Guard as a surfman from 1925 to 1927. (Courtesy George W. Warrington III Family Archives) Back to the edition of: Mar/Apr 2020
